More about first aid courses in Klemzig
Discover a range of essential First Aid Courses in Klemzig designed for beginners looking to gain invaluable life-saving skills. Whether you are interested in learning how to assist clients with medication or providing immediate support in emergencies, Klemzig offers various options to suit your needs. The comprehensive Provide First Aid (HLTAID011) course is particularly popular, equipping you with the techniques necessary to respond effectively in various scenarios.
In Klemzig, several reputable training providers ensure you receive quality education in first aid. For instance, Red Cross offers the Provide Basic Emergency Life Support (HLTAID010) course, teaching critical response procedures in emergencies. Additionally, Link Resources and St John Ambulance Australia provide courses in CPR (HLTAID009) and the Occupational First Aid Skill Set (HLTSS00068), respectively, focusing on specific skills required in various job roles.
Enrolling in a first aid course in Klemzig not only boosts your employability but also empowers you to make a difference in your community. With courses like Advanced Resuscitation and Oxygen Therapy (HLTAID015) on offer, students can further enhance their skill set to address advanced medical situations. The local providers, including AGAE and Tactical Training, ensure that residents receive face-to-face training in a supportive environment.
